Galpin Homes Salary

How much does the Galpin Homes Pay for employees?

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Galpin Homes in the United States is $81,663.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$39. Salaries at Galpin Homes typically range from $71,943 to $92,162 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Galpin Homes’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Medford?

Understanding the cost of living near Medford is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Galpin Homes.
Medford's Cost of Living Index is approximately 102.5 (2.5% more expensive than US average; 10.9% less than OR average). Southern OR city, more affordable housing than Portland/Bend. RVTD b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Galpin Homes,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,100 - $1,600+ A significant portion of Galpin Homes sal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$110 - $200 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$40 (RVTD mon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$410 - $600 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$690+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,380 - $3,740+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
